Everyone’s been watching mortgage rates, but there’s another trend buyers shouldn’t overlook: the seasonal shift that happens in the housing market every fall.
As summer winds down, the market often starts to change. More homes may come on the market, asking prices can become a little more flexible, and sellers may be more open to negotiating. For buyers, that can create opportunities that aren’t always as easy to find during the busier spring and summer months.
But here’s the important part: seasonal trends don’t look exactly the same in every market. What’s happening nationally may be very different from what’s happening right here in our local area.
